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Cách sử dụng $ _GET để nhận nhiều tham số bằng cách sử dụng cùng một tên trong PHP

PHP hơi kỳ lạ ở đây. Sử dụng trình phân tích cú pháp dữ liệu biểu mẫu chuẩn của nó, bạn phải kết thúc tên của điều khiển bằng [] để truy cập nhiều hơn một trong số chúng.

<input type="checkbox" name="foo[]" value="bar">
<input type="checkbox" name="foo[]" value="bar">
<input type="checkbox" name="foo[]" value="bar">

Sẽ có sẵn dưới dạng một mảng trong:

$_GET['foo'][]

Nếu bạn không muốn đổi tên các trường, thì bạn sẽ cần có quyền truy cập vào dữ liệu thô ($_SERVER['REQUEST_URI'] ) và tự phân tích cú pháp (không phải thứ tôi muốn giới thiệu).



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Làm cách nào để nhập tệp .sql trong cơ sở dữ liệu mysql bằng PHP?

  2. Làm cách nào để đặt bí danh một trường hoặc cột trong MySQL?

  3. Làm cách nào tôi có thể thực hiện nhiều truy vấn trong một trang?

  4. Ví dụ SYSDATE () - MySQL

  5. MySQL CASE hoạt động như thế nào?